INTRODUCTION: Esophagogastroduodenoscopy is the most important tool to detect gastric cancer (GC). In this study, we developed a computer-aided detection (CADe) system to detect GC with white light imaging (WLI) and linked color imaging (LCI) modes and aimed to compare the performance of CADe with that of endoscopists. METHODS: The system was developed based on the deep learning framework from 9,021 images in 385 patients between 2017 and 2020. A total of 116 LCI and WLI videos from 110 patients between 2017 and 2023 were used to evaluate per-case sensitivity and per-frame specificity. RESULTS: The per-case sensitivity and per-frame specificity of CADe with a confidence level of 0.5 in detecting GC were 78.6% and 93.4% for WLI and 94.0% and 93.3% for LCI, respectively (p < 0.001). The per-case sensitivities of nonexpert endoscopists for WLI and LCI were 45.8% and 80.4%, whereas those of expert endoscopists were 66.7% and 90.6%, respectively. Regarding detectability between CADe and endoscopists, the per-case sensitivities for WLI and LCI were 78.6% and 94.0% in CADe, respectively, which were significantly higher than those for LCI in experts (90.6%, p = 0.004) and those for WLI and LCI in nonexperts (45.8% and 80.4%, respectively, p < 0.001); however, no significant difference for WLI was observed between CADe and experts (p = 0.134). CONCLUSIONS: Our CADe system showed significantly better sensitivity in detecting GC when used in LCI compared with WLI mode. Moreover, the sensitivity of CADe using LCI is significantly higher than those of expert endoscopists using LCI to detect GC.

BACKGROUND AND OBJECTIVE: Several endoscopic resection methods have been developed as less invasive treatments for superficial non-ampullary duodenal epithelial tumours. This study aimed to compare outcomes of conventional endoscopic mucosal resection and underwater endoscopic mucosal resection for superficial non-ampullary duodenal epithelial tumours, including resection depth and rate of the muscularis mucosa contained under the lesion. METHODS: This single-centre retrospective cohort study conducted from January 2009 to December 2021 enrolled patients who underwent conventional endoscopic mucosal resection and underwater endoscopic mucosal resection for superficial non-ampullary duodenal epithelial tumours and investigated their clinicopathological outcomes using propensity score matching. RESULTS: Of the 285 superficial non-ampullary duodenal epithelial tumours, 98 conventional endoscopic mucosal resections and 187 underwater endoscopic mucosal resections were included. After propensity score matching, 64 conventional endoscopic mucosal resections and 64 underwater endoscopic mucosal resections were analysed. The R0 resection rate was significantly higher in underwater endoscopic mucosal resection cases than in conventional endoscopic mucosal resection cases (70.3% vs. 50.0%; P = 0.030). In the multivariate analysis, a lesion diameter > 10 mm (odds ratio 7.246; P = 0.001), being in the 1st-50th treatment period (odds ratio 3.405; P = 0.008), and undergoing conventional endoscopic mucosal resection (odds ratio 3.617; P = 0.016) were associated with RX/R1 resection. Furthermore, in underwater endoscopic mucosal resection cases, the R0 rate was significantly higher for lesions diameter ≤10 mm than >10 mm, and was significantly higher in the 51st-treatment period than in the 1st-50th period. Conventional endoscopic mucosal resection and underwater endoscopic mucosal resection cases showed no significant difference in resection depth and muscularis mucosa containing rate. CONCLUSIONS: Underwater endoscopic mucosal resection may be more acceptable than conventional endoscopic mucosal resection for superficial non-ampullary duodenal epithelial tumours ≤ 10 mm. A steep early learning curve may be acquired for underwater endoscopic mucosal resection. Large multicentre prospective studies need to be conducted to confirm the effectiveness of underwater endoscopic mucosal resection.

BACKGROUND AND AIMS: This retrospective study aimed to compare the short- and long-term outcomes of endoscopic submucosal dissection and laparoscopic and endoscopic cooperative surgery in patients with superficial non-ampullary duodenal epithelial tumors. PATIENTS AND METHODS: We investigated consecutive patients with SNADETs > 10 mm in size who underwent ESD (ESD group) or LECS (LECS group) between January 2015 and March 2021. The data was used to analyze the clinical course, management, survival status, and recurrence between the two groups. RESULTS: A total of 113 patients (100 and 13 in the ESD and LECS groups, respectively) were investigated. The rates of en bloc resection and curative resection were 100% vs. 100% and 93.0% vs. 77.0% in the ESD and LECS groups, respectively, with no significant difference. The ESD group had shorter resection and suturing times than the LECS group, but there were no significant difference after propensity score matching. There were also no differences in the rates of postoperative adverse event (7.0% vs. 23.1%; P = 0.161). The 3-year overall survival (OS) rate was high in both the ESD and LECS groups (97.6% vs. 100%; P = 0.334). One patient in the ESD group experienced recurrence due to liver metastasis; however, no deaths related to SNADETs were observed. CONCLUSION: ESD and LECS are both acceptable treatments for SNADETs in terms of a high OS rate and a low long-term recurrence rate, thereby achieving a comparable high rate of curative resection. Further studies are necessary to compare the outcomes of ESD and LECS for SNADETs once both techniques are developed further.

Conventional clip closure of mucosal defects after duodenal endoscopic submucosal dissection decreases the incidence of delayed adverse events, but may result in incomplete closure, depending on size or location. This study aimed to assess the effectiveness of the underwater clip closure method for complete duodenal defect closure without the difficulties associated with conventional closure methods. We investigated 19 patients with 20 lesions who underwent endoscopic submucosal dissection of the duodenum and subsequent mucosal defect closure in underwater conditions at our facility between February 2021 and January 2022. The success rate of the underwater clip closure method was defined as the complete endoscopic closure of the mucosal defect; a success rate of 100% was achieved. The median resected specimen size was 34.3 mm, the median procedure time for mucosal defect closure was 14 min, and the median number of clips used per patient was 12. No delayed adverse events were observed. The underwater clip closure method is a feasible option for complete closure of mucosal defects, regardless of the size or location of a duodenal endoscopic submucosal dissection.

After endoscopic treatment for esophageal cancer, a 65-year-old male underwent surveillance esophagogastroduodenoscopy. A 12-mm discolored flat lesion was noted on the greater curvature of the middle gastric body. Magnifying endoscopy with blue laser imaging demonstrated an irregular papillary surface. Biopsy revealed atypical cells with mucus and irregularly distributed nuclei. The lesion was diagnosed as a gastric-type neoplasm with low atypia. Thereafter, endoscopic submucosal dissection (ESD) was conducted and specimen was sent for biopsy. The ESD specimen suggested a signet-ring cell carcinoma with MUC5AC-positive phenotype and adenocarcinoma of the fundic gland type, with MUC6 positivity and pepsinogen I positivity in the shallow and deeper layers, respectively. Moreover, the cervical region of fundic glands demonstrated a transformation zone of the signet-ring cell carcinoma into an adenocarcinoma of the fundic gland type. Herein, we report this rare case along with a literature review.

A 70-year-old man presented to our hospital with fever and abdominal pain. A mass was found in the left lobe of his liver. Three months later, disseminated peritoneal nodules and ascites appeared. Liver biopsy and review laparoscopy did not lead to a diagnosis. Approximately five months later, a pathological autopsy was performed, and a final diagnosis of sarcomatoid intrahepatic cholangiocarcinoma was made. Differentiating sarcomatoid cholangiocarcinoma from sarcomatoid malignant peritoneal mesothelioma was difficult due to the similarity of clinical and pathological findings. Because the two diseases are treated differently, being able to differentiate them is a challenge in the future.

Gastric mucosa-associated lymphoid tissue (MALT) lymphomas have various endoscopic appearances. We report a case of Helicobacter pylori-negative gastric MALT lymphoma with a protruding morphology similar to that of submucosal tumors. A 51-year-old man with a protruding tumor in the gastric cardia was referred to our hospital. Biopsy specimens showed no malignant epithelial tumors or lymphoid hyperplasia. Endoscopic submucosal dissection was performed and the patient was diagnosed with gastric MALT lymphoma. Lymphoma cells were present in the lamina propria mucosae and the submucosa under the non-atrophic fundic gland mucosa, with a feature of homogenous and monotonous growths, which was speculated to have resulted in a protruding morphology similar to that of submucosal tumors. Endoscopic submucosal dissection can be an alternative diagnostic option for gastric MALT lymphoma when the initial pathological diagnosis based on biopsy specimens is difficult.

Objectives: We aimed to conduct a systematic review and meta-analysis to assess the value of image-enhanced endoscopy including blue laser imaging (BLI), linked color imaging, narrow-band imaging (NBI), and texture and color enhancement imaging to detect and diagnose gastric cancer (GC) compared to that of white-light imaging (WLI). Methods: Studies meeting the inclusion criteria were identified through PubMed, Cochrane Library, and Japan Medical Abstracts Society databases searches. The pooled risk ratio for dichotomous variables was calculated using the random-effects model to assess the GC detection between WLI and image-enhanced endoscopy. A random-effects model was used to calculate the overall diagnostic performance of WLI and magnifying image-enhanced endoscopy for GC. Results: Sixteen studies met the inclusion criteria. The detection rate of GC was significantly improved in linked color imaging compared with that in WLI (risk ratio, 2.20; 95% confidence interval [CI], 1.39-3.25; p < 0.01) with mild heterogeneity. Magnifying endoscopy with NBI (ME-NBI) obtained a pooled sensitivity, specificity, and area under the summary receiver operating curve of 0.84 (95 % CI, 0.80-0.88), 0.96 (95 % CI, 0.94-0.97), and 0.92, respectively. Similarly, ME-BLI showed a pooled sensitivity, specificity, and area under the curve of 0.81 (95 % CI, 0.77-0.85), 0.85 (95 % CI, 0.82-0.88), and 0.95, respectively. The diagnostic efficacy of ME-NBI/BLI for GC was evidently high compared to that of WLI, However, significant heterogeneity among the NBI studies still existed. Conclusions: Our meta-analysis showed a high detection rate for linked color imaging and a high diagnostic performance of ME-NBI/BLI for GC compared to that with WLI.
